FAQs

What time is check-in?

Check-in time is at 2:00 p.m.

What time is check-out?

Check-out time is at 12:00 p.m.

How can I reserve a camp site?

You can reserve an available spot by clicking “Book Now”. You will be required to pay in full for your stay using a VISA or MASTERCARD.   Nightly, weekly, and monthly (up to 62 days) reservations can be processed online. If  interested in a longer time frame, please call our office for rates and availability.  Long term reservations paying month to month, if rent is not received by the 15th of the month there is a $20 late fee. Every additional 15 days after will accrue $20.

Do you require a deposit?

Nightly and weekly reservations do require a $25 trash deposit. Monthly reservations do require a $200 electric/trash deposit.

Where do I go to check-in?

All reservations are pre-booked online, so there is no office check-in needed. You will receive your parking pass via email along with your confirmation. This will be placed in your windshield during your stay as proof of registration.

What if I need to cancel?

All cancellations must be made 72 hours in advance of arrival or 50% of your total rental will be charged  Please call or email the office to do so.

Do I need a parking pass?

Yes you will receive your confirmation & parking pass email after your confirmed booking.   Please print this out and place in your windshield.  Make clearly visible during your stay as proof of registration.  Pass is good for use of the boat ramp as well.

What do I do with my trash?

All trash is to be bagged and disposed of in the campground dumpster located in the boat ramp parking area.  Please leave the site completely cleared and clean or you will forfeit the deposit.

Can I bring my pet along?

Pets are welcome but must be on a leash at all times. Owners are to clean up after their pets and should not leave dogs unattended. Excessive barking that disturbs other campers is not acceptable and renters will be asked to leave.

Do you have quiet hours?

County ordinance quiet hours are between 10 pm through sunrise. No loud music permitted at any time.  Please be courteous of your neighbors.

Can I have a camp fire at my site?

Please burn firewood only in fire pit provided and do not leave unattended. No trash should be left behind in fire pit upon departure and please do not move fire pit.  You can purchase a bundle of firewood by adding it to your reservation upon booking.  Do not burn during county regulated “no burn” periods.

Do you offer a late check-out?

Please call the office to request a late check-out.  If available, we can offer a complimentary late check-out of 2:00 pm.  Checkouts after 2:00 PM will have an additional nightly fee charged.

How many vehicles can I park on site?

There is a limit of one RV and two vehicles per camp site. Any additional vehicles will need to park in the extra parking area in the campground.

What if someone wants to visit me?

You can have visitors, but the maximum occupancy per site is not to exceed 6 people.  If you already have two vehicles on your site, your guest will need to park in the additional parking area.  No tents allowed.

Can I bring my golf cart?

Golf carts are allowed in the campground,  but no ATV’s of any kind.  Please follow speed limit signs.

What is not allowed? No exposed firearms will be permitted.

Drunken and disorderly conduct will not be tolerated. No alcohol consumption by minors. No fireworks.

Are bicycles allowed?

Bicycles are allowed, please do not ride after dark.

Is there a swimming area?

Yes, there is a designated swimming area near the fishing pier. Please swim at your own risk as there are no lifeguards on duty.

Can I buy camping supplies there?

We do not have camping or fishing supplies for purchase on site.  We do have ice and firewood available for purchase, just add it at the check out screen. The closest stores will be the Enmark Gas Station located 4 miles from the campground at the corner of Old Lexington Hwy and Hwy 378, Weed’s Landing located 5 miles away at 3230 Hwy 378, and a Dollar General about 13 miles away at 2610 Hwy 378.

Will I be able to fish?

Of course! The campground does have a fishing pier for guest use. However, South Carolina does require a fishing license.  Department of Natural Resources does ticket for fishing without a license.  You can purchase one here: http://www.dnr.sc.gov/purchase.html or our local fishing stores:  Weed’s Landing located 5 miles from the campground at 3230 Hwy 378.

Can I bring my boat?

Yes. You can bring your boat and use the boat ramp.  Your camp site registration is your boat ramp pass for one boat.

Can I plug a 50 amp into a 30 amp site?

Yes, but you will need an adapter to do so. We rent these for a daily rate of $3.00. If it is lost or not returned, there will be a $40.00 fee charged to the credit card on file.
